  If you are honest, people will trust you. Itis important for a person to have a reputa-tion for being honest. If a person is dishonest,no one will want to be his friend. He will soonbecome an outcast. On the other hand,anhonest man wins the respect of others.

  Honesty is,indeed, the best policy.

   诚实的人 

    你若诚实,人们就会信任你。对一个人来说,拥有诚实的信誉是很重要的。一个人若不诚实,就没有人会想和他做朋友。不久他就会被人拒于千里之外。另一方面说来,诚实的人会赢得别人的尊敬。诚实确实是上策.
